Skip to content

Conversation

@ChristophWurst
Copy link
Member

We have run tests with PHP8.5 for a long time. Now that server supports 8.5 we can allow it too.

The test workflow is already adjusted for 8.6 once we add it to the matrix.

Signed-off-by: Christoph Wurst <[email protected]>
@DerDreschner
Copy link
Contributor

DerDreschner commented Jan 9, 2026

Is there a separate ticket to check and update our dependencies against PHP 8.5? I'm asking as there are a bunch of deprecation warnings when using >= 8.5. https://github.com/nextcloud/mail/actions/runs/20856973971/job/59926192916?pr=12227#step:11:30

(A lot of them should appear with PHP 8.4 as well according to the deprecation warning, but they don't in our PHP 8.4 pipeline for some reason 🤔 )

@ChristophWurst
Copy link
Member Author

I suggest we fix them in the coming weeks as we see them pop up on CI or with local testing

@ChristophWurst ChristophWurst merged commit deb9fde into main Jan 12, 2026
43 of 45 checks passed
@ChristophWurst ChristophWurst deleted the feat/deps/php85 branch January 12, 2026 08:58
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Projects

None yet

Development

Successfully merging this pull request may close these issues.

3 participants